W E L L N E S S  C E N T E R



In early June 2006, construction of the Wellness Center began in earnest with the removal of several trees and the College’s tennis courts to make way for CNR’s new sports facility, and excavation of the site soon followed. In August, the first forms were poured for the pool foundation as the building's footprint began to emerge.
 
By September, the foundation of the swimming pool was in place and October saw the footings and foundation of the locker rooms. To achieve all of this, deep drilling of the solid rock foundation was required. During the fall months, three huge drills were working simultaneously to remove rocks that will be recycled. 
 
Construction continued at the Wellness Center without interruption as workers brave the very cold weather to keep on schedule. The “topping off” phase was completed by late February, marking a significant milestone in the progress of the Wellness Center's constructionWhen completed, CNR’s interdisciplinary center will integrate all aspects of health and wellness education in a holistic manner. The ecological design of the building as a metaphor for wellness will be eligible for certification by the U.S. Green Building Council under its Leadership in Energy and Environmental Design (LEED) Green Building Rating System.
